Each Member Travels along his or her own course of development
In this diverse group of 25 to 30 professionals, the common thread
is the desire and commitment to improve public speaking and leadership
skills. Using the TM international plan, each member is traveling along
his or her own course of development. Some members are very new and
have only one or two speeches under their belt. Others have been members
for years and are continuing to improve their already stellar presentations.
The Environment Encourages Gentle Evaluations
Many are well on their way to developing their leadership skills by
holding club offices. No matter what amount of experience, all members
of this positive and enthusiastic group heartily support one another
in an environment of encourage and gentle evaluation.

Come join our Atmosphere of Learning
Our club meets every Wednesday, from noon to 1:00 PM, at the Tigard
Public Library at 13500 SW Hall Blvd. Tigard, OR 97223. Our alternate
location is the WestView Plaza in suite 200. Please contact us prior
to attending to make certain of our location that day. At every meeting,
we try to create an atmosphere of learning, support and enjoyment. We
have fun while we improve ourselves.
